About The Klezmatics

The Klezmatics matter because they breathe new life into klezmer music, transforming it from a traditional form into a vibrant expression that resonates with contemporary audiences.
They have helped redefine the cultural significance of Eastern European Jewish folk traditions, integrating them with modern influences to create a bridge between past and present.

This revitalization has allowed klezmer to not only survive but flourish, inspiring a new generation to engage with this rich cultural heritage. Their approach is marked by a willingness to innovate while honoring tradition, often incorporating elements from various musical styles without sacrificing the core essence of klezmer. The Klezmatics seamlessly blend complex melodies and rhythms, creating an energetic atmosphere that turns their performances into spirited celebrations. By embracing improvisation, they invite spontaneity and dialogue within their compositions, making each show a unique experience that connects the audience to the music in real time. In their songwriting, themes frequently revolve around joy, loss, resilience, and the immigrant experience. They employ a storytelling approach that balances sincerity with irony, crafting narratives that evoke deep emotions while inviting listeners to reflect on universal human experiences. Their lyrics resonate with both personal and collective histories, often using humor alongside poignant observations to explore the intricacies of life.
